The world’s first mountain-climbing cog, or rack-and-pinion, railway. Summits Mount Washington in New Hampshire. The Mount Washington Cog Railway is the second steepest in the world with an average grade of 25% over its 3 miles of track. Spanning four centuries in its 10 acres, Strawbery Banke is one of the best living history villages in New England and a must for any Portsmouth newcomer. Against a backdrop of more than three dozen historic buildings and several vintage gardens, costumed interpreters and artisans lead visitors back in time, while formal ... Portsmouth is one of New England’s best-kept secrets, located where the Piscataqua River meets the Atlantic. It’s known for historic 17th and 18th century buildings, bustling Market Square, and of course, a huge port.
